Current conservation, meson-exchange currents, and magnetic form factors of 3He and 3H
Description
The effect of the requirement of current conservation for meson-exchange currents containing the πNN form factor is investigated for the magnetic form factors of 3He and 3H. The effect is substantial for the pionic current contribution but is small for the total contribution to the momentum transfer, Q <= 5 fm-1. (orig.)
